Michael Cleveland, a nationally celebrated bluegrass fiddler from Henryville, Indiana merges tradition and innovation in his music. Cleveland started playing the fiddle at age four and had performed with “The Father of Bluegrass Music” Bill Monroe by age nine. He formed the award-winning band Flamekeeper in 2006 and has since earned several awards, including a Grammy for his album Tall Fiddler.
For thirty years, Jason Carter has been the fiddle player for the Del McCoury Band - the most awarded group in bluegrass history. Carter has won three Grammy awards, including 2018’s “Best Bluegrass Album” with The Travelin’ McCourys, of which he is a founding member. Louisville native Dean Heckel has been performing covers and originals since the mid-2010s. Influenced by all genres and inspired by the blues, Heckel’s sound is adored by many in the local live music scene.
